Rhabarbarum commonly known as Victoria Rhubarb is a deciduous perennial vegetable and a member of the buckwheat family called Polygonaceae. Originally native to Southern Siberia and named by the Russians, Rhubarb is now grown in much of Europe and North America. In 1837 Joseph Myatt, an English plant breeder cultivated his variety of Rhubarb and named it after Queen Victoria, giving it the name Victoria Rhubarb. Myatt’s variety has the distinct red stalks that Rhubarb is known for today. The leaves of the Rhubarb plant are inedible but the beautiful stalks are used in jams, jellies, pies, and many other desserts! Rhubarb is easy to grow and once established will return year after year making it a delicious and unique garden staple!
